GORDON, marked STERLING on reverse 6 oclock arm, missing ribbon, lovely patina, extremely fine. A Victory Medal, in bronze gilt, rim impressed 15027 PTE. R. S. GORDON. F. G. H., light wear, extremely fine. Footnote: Robert Stewart Gordon was born in Scotland in 1888. He was employed as a labourer when enlisted on September 24, 1914 at Valcartier. He disembarked the SS Lapland in England
